summa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/net/eathena/packetsout.inc22
1 files changed, 11 insertions, 11 deletions
diff --git a/src/net/eathena/packetsout.inc b/src/net/eathena/packetsout.inc
index edf80c934..97f1c359d 100644
--- a/src/net/eathena/packetsout.inc
+++ b/src/net/eathena/packetsout.inc
@@ -37,21 +37,21 @@ packet(CMSG_LOGIN_REGISTER_KEY, 0x01db, 0, lclif->p->parse_CA_REQ_HA
packet(CMSG_NAME_REQUEST, 0x0094, 6, clif->pGetCharNameRequest);
packet(CMSG_CHAR_PASSWORD_CHANGE, 0x0061, 0, nullptr);
-packet(CMSG_CHAR_SERVER_CONNECT, 0x0065, 0, nullptr);
-packet(CMSG_CHAR_SELECT, 0x0066, 0, nullptr);
-packet(CMSG_CHAR_CREATE, 0x0067, 0, nullptr);
-packet(CMSG_CHAR_DELETE, 0x0068, 0, nullptr);
-packet(CMSG_CHAR_CREATE_PIN, 0x08ba, 0, nullptr);
-packet(CMSG_CHAR_CHECK_RENAME, 0x08fc, 0, nullptr);
-packet(CMSG_CHAR_RENAME, 0x028f, 0, nullptr);
-packet(CMSG_CHAR_CHANGE_SLOT, 0x08d4, 0, nullptr);
+packet(CMSG_CHAR_SERVER_CONNECT, 0x0065, 0, chr->parse_char_connect);
+packet(CMSG_CHAR_SELECT, 0x0066, 0, chr->parse_char_select);
+packet(CMSG_CHAR_CREATE, 0x0067, 0, chr->parse_char_create_new_char);
+packet(CMSG_CHAR_DELETE, 0x0068, 0, chr->parse_char_delete_char_0068);
+packet(CMSG_CHAR_CREATE_PIN, 0x08ba, 0, chr->parse_char_pincode_first_pin);
+packet(CMSG_CHAR_CHECK_RENAME, 0x08fc, 0, chr->parse_char_rename_char);
+packet(CMSG_CHAR_RENAME, 0x028f, 0, chr->parse_char_rename_char_confirm);
+packet(CMSG_CHAR_CHANGE_SLOT, 0x08d4, 0, chr->parse_char_move_character);
packet(CMSG_MAP_SERVER_CONNECT, 0x0072, 19, clif->pWantToConnection);
packet(CMSG_MAP_PING, 0x007e, 6, clif->pTickSend);
packet(CMSG_LOGIN_PING, 0x0200, 0, lclif->p->parse_CA_CONNECT_INFO_CHANGED);
packet(CMSG_LOGIN_HASH_CHECK, 0x0204, 0, lclif->p->parse_CA_EXE_HASHCHECK);
-packet(CMSG_CHAR_PING, 0x0187, 0, nullptr);
+packet(CMSG_CHAR_PING, 0x0187, 0, chr->parse_char_ping);
packet(CMSG_MAP_LOADED, 0x007d, 2, clif->pLoadEndAck);
packet(CMSG_CLIENT_QUIT, 0x018A, 4, clif->pQuitGame);
@@ -617,7 +617,7 @@ if (packetVersion >= 20120307)
packet(CMSG_BUYINGSTORE_OPEN, 0x0360, 6, clif->pReqClickBuyingStore);
packet(CMSG_SEARCHSTORE_SEARCH, 0x0884, -1, clif->pSearchStoreInfo);
packet(CMSG_MAP_SERVER_CONNECT, 0x086A, 19, clif->pWantToConnection);
- packet(CMSG_CHAR_CREATE, 0x0970, 0, nullptr);
+ packet(CMSG_CHAR_CREATE, 0x0970, 0, chr->parse_char_create_new_char);
packet(CMSG_MAP_PING, 0x0887, 6, clif->pTickSend);
packet(CMSG_PLAYER_CHANGE_DIR, 0x0890, 5, clif->pChangeDir);
packet(CMSG_ITEM_PICKUP, 0x0865, 6, clif->pTakeItem);
@@ -1290,7 +1290,7 @@ if (packetVersion >= 20151001)
packet(CMSG_SOLVE_CHAR_NAME, 0x0368, 6, clif->pSolveCharName);
packet(CMSG_BUYINGSTORE_CREATE, 0x0815, -1, clif->pReqOpenBuyingStore);
packet(CMSG_NAME_REQUEST, 0x096a, 6, clif->pGetCharNameRequest);
- packet(CMSG_CHAR_CREATE, 0x0a39, 0, nullptr);
+ packet(CMSG_CHAR_CREATE, 0x0a39, 0, chr->parse_char_create_new_char);
}
// 20151104